As a professional artist with over twenty-five years experience teaching, I can guide you through a series of drawing exercises that will help you learn to draw what you see with confidence while also having fun!

This class is for beginners or anyone needing extra practice boosting their drawing skills to the next level. By the end of this class you will be able to recognise, understand and use perspective, proportion, shading and various drawing techniques with success!

I'm a very patient, caring teacher and understand where you're coming from and what your fears may be so just come with an open mind and a willingness to play!
Extra information
Have pencils and paper and an eraser ready to go and a reliable internet connection too! You may need a hard surface to draw on.

Practicing between lessons helps you achieve success too so don't forget to practice at least one hour a day if you want to see results!

Egg tempera is one of the most ancient historical art painting technique. It preserved as a main technique to paint orthodox religious icons. It is possible to learn it and paint your own icon. I have 12 years of practice teaching people how to do it. We work together step by step to understand the technique, the way to prepare wooden panel to paint an icon and the techniques of making a good project to make the icon fit to the board. We also learn how to make gold leaf layer on the halos. Your icon will be a real, crafted icon.

Artistic development starts by identifying your artistic interest. As artists, we don’t always know why we draw and paint the things that we do. Yet they are not random. What captivates us or draws us towards certain artworks? This might be the tonal way in which light reflects, structural forms or mathematical division. The point being, is that we all have such aesthetic interests and step 1 is finding out what interests you!

Step 2 is helping you express your interests through painting techniques, styles and materiality. But it all starts with you. What do you want to say? And how? I will help you do this through discussion, looking at your previous work (if you have any), introducing you to a LARGE variety of artists, potentially copying their styles. I adjust my classes according to your needs.

The goal is simple: to come to understand your artistic interest, help you find techniques to express them and develop your artistic language.

(Please note that just because you have found an artistic interest and a way to express it, it does not mean that you must do only one thing for the rest of your life. It is the downfall of creativity to repeat and paint the same way over and over again. Instead, allow your interests to drive your creativity. Let it be the starting point, venture out and discover it from various angles and ways of expressing it. But also be mindful that as we grow our interests can change and as they change, we must remain honest and respond accordingly such that our artistic language can also grow.)
